Creole Cuisine
Speaking of food, you absolutely have to try the Creole cuisine. It's a delicious blend of French, African, and Caribbean flavors. Think spicy stews, fresh seafood, and exotic fruits. Your taste buds will thank you! Some must-try dishes include accras de morue (cod fritters), poulet boucané (smoked chicken), and colombo (a flavorful curry). And don't forget to wash it all down with a refreshing glass of Ti Punch, a local rum-based cocktail. Local Music and Dance
And what's a Caribbean experience without music and dance? The local music scene in Martinique is vibrant and diverse, with influences from African, French, and Latin American traditions. You'll hear everything from zouk and reggae to traditional Creole music. Don't be surprised if you find yourself tapping your feet and dancing along! Many local bars and clubs offer live music performances, providing a great opportunity to immerse yourself in the island's culture. Dance is an integral part of Martinican culture, with traditional dances such as the bélè and quadrille still performed at festivals and celebrations. These dances are a reflection of the island's history and cultural heritage, with each movement telling a story. Tips for Planning Your Trip
Before you pack your bags, here are a few tips to help you plan your trip:
- Best Time to Visit: The best time to visit Martinique is during the dry season, which runs from December to May. The weather is sunny and pleasant, with average temperatures in the mid-80s.
 - What to Pack: Pack light, breathable clothing, swimwear, sunscreen, and insect repellent. Don't forget your camera to capture all the stunning scenery!
 - Language: French is the official language of Martinique, so it's helpful to learn a few basic phrases before you go. However, many locals also speak English, especially in tourist areas.
 - Currency: The currency in Martinique is the Euro (€). Credit cards are widely accepted, but it's always a good idea to have some cash on hand for smaller establishments and local markets.
